Diverse Range of Programs and Schools
The university is organized into numerous specialized schools, offering a vast array of undergraduate and graduate programs. Students can pursue degrees in business through the Marshall School of Business, law via the Gould School of Law, and public policy at the Price School of Public Policy. The USC Dornsife College of Letters, Arts and Sciences provides a broad liberal arts foundation, while the USC Viterbi School of Engineering is renowned for its cutting-edge technological research. This diversity ensures that prospective students can find a perfect fit for their specific career aspirations.

Campus Life and Student Experience
Beyond the lecture halls, USC offers a dynamic student experience that is integral to its appeal. The Trojans, as the athletic teams are known, compete in the NCAA Division I, creating a spirited school culture centered around football games at the iconic Los Angeles Memorial Coliseum. The university boasts over 1,000 student organizations, ensuring that every interest is catered to. Residential life is vibrant, with modern dormitories and themed housing options helping students build community and network lifelong friendships.

Admissions and Financial Considerations
Admission to USC is highly competitive, with the university seeking well-rounded students who demonstrate academic prowess, leadership, and unique personal qualities. The admissions process considers standardized test scores (though currently test-optional), high school GPA, extracurricular activities, and compelling personal essays. While the cost of attendance is substantial, USC offers substantial financial aid packages, including merit-based scholarships, to help qualifying students manage the investment in their future.
